Slice Of Life continues where Tequila Nites left off for the ever consistent Michael Woods. Reflecting one of the things that the globe trotting dj loves most in life, this is his homage to pizza! Yes yes, we know he loves working out alongside a cheeky tequila but there’s nothing closer to his heart than a slice with pepperoni.
With a carefully crafted and hypnotic drop that bangs back in, this dancefloor destroyer skillfully lures you in. It’s a lean, mean piece – all meat and no cheese. Get yourself a slice of life right here!
